What is the "Basis Weight" of a paper
The basis weight of a paper is the weight of 500 sheets, measured in pounds, in that paper's basic sheet size. It is important to note that the "basic sheet size" is not the same for all types of paper and it is never 8 1/2 x 11. 8 1/2 x 11... Read More »

What about basis weight of the paper?
Usually 24# and 28# papers are used. However, 38#, 80# & 100# tag can be used for some applications along with certain security papers. However, one should be aware that all folder/ sealers do not handle these heavier basis weights. Read More »
